
Lil Wayne was involved in a big controversy this past week for throwing some dollars into the crowd out east. (The majority of the fetti was just $1, $5, $10 and $20 bills.) Regardless, he's in some hot water, again.
Morgan State University Campus Police may pursue criminal charges against Weezy because the stack chunking eventually led to a melee that left three women injured. There were also a couple of interesting comments from Morgan State officials, check out this off the wall comparison here:
"It was as dangerous a thing to do as standing in a crowded movie theater and shouting, ’Fire,”’
--said
Clinton Coleman, a Morgan State spokesman.
